Поделиться через


Метод ITextFont::SetKerning (tom.h)

Задает минимальный размер шрифта, при котором выполняется кернинг.

Синтаксис

HRESULT SetKerning(
  [in] float Value
);

Параметры

[in] Value

Тип: float

Новое значение минимального размера кернинга в точках с плавающей запятой.

Возвращаемое значение

Тип: HRESULT

Если метод завершается успешно, он возвращает S_OK. Если метод завершается сбоем, он возвращает один из следующих кодов com-ошибок. Дополнительные сведения о кодах ошибок COM см. в разделе Обработка ошибок в COM.

Код возврата Описание
E_INVALIDARG
Недопустимый аргумент.
CO_E_RELEASED
Объект шрифта прикрепляется к удаленному диапазону.
E_ACCESSDENIED
Доступ на запись запрещен.
E_OUTOFMEMORY
Недостаточно памяти.

Комментарии

Если это значение равно нулю, кернинг отключен. Положительные значения включите кернинг пары для размеров шрифтов, превышающих это значение кернинга. Например, значение 1 включает кернинг для всех удобочитаемых размеров, а 16 — кернинг только для шрифтов размером 16 точек и больше.

Требования

   
Минимальная версия клиента Windows Vista [только классические приложения]
Минимальная версия сервера Windows Server 2003 [только классические приложения]
Целевая платформа Windows
Header tom.h
DLL Msftedit.dll

См. также раздел

Основные понятия

GetKerning

ITextFont

Справочные материалы

Текстовая объектная модель